$A$ is the point $(5,2)$ while $B$ is the point $(9,6)$. $AC$ runs parallel to the $x$-axis, and $CB$ runs parallel to the $y$-axis. The equation for the line $AB$ is $x - y = 3$.
(a)[1]
Determine the coordinates of $C$.
(b)[3]
The area inside triangle $ABC$ is described by three inequalities. State these inequalities.
(c)[2]
The point $(a,b)$, with $a$ and $b$ both integers, is inside triangle $ABC$. It also lies on the line $y = \frac{1}{2}x$. Find the value of $a$ and the value of $b$.
